Remarks
The strings are internally stored in a String<TString> object and the character position type is a Pair (seqNo,seqOfs) where seqNo identifies the string within the stringset and seqOfs identifies the position within this string.
The position type can be returned or modified by the meta-function SAValue called with the StringSet type.
